Date | Name | Activity | Value |
|---|---|---|---|
Feb 27, 2026 | xxxxxxxxxxxxx | $99192 | |
Nov 18, 2025 | xxxxxxxxxxxxx | $74786 | |
May 08, 2025 | xxxxxxxxxxxxx | $101631 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$212627 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1271114 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1556420 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$2952441 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 9,405,971 | Institution | 10.15% | 736,581,589 | |
| 7,514,022 | Insider | 8.11% | 588,423,063 | |
| 7,510,871 | Institution | 8.10% | 588,176,308 | |
| 7,399,844 | Institution | 7.98% | 579,481,784 | |
| 7,270,542 | Institution | 7.84% | 569,356,144 | |
| 1,826,480 | Institution | 1.97% | 143,031,649 | |
| 1,628,705 | Institution | 1.76% | 127,543,889 | |
| 1,587,600 | Institution | 1.71% | 124,324,956 | |
| 1,418,108 | Institution | 1.53% | 111,052,037 | |
| 1,103,354 | Institution | 1.19% | 86,403,652 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 7,270,542 | Institution | 7.84% | 569,356,144 | |
| 1,628,705 | Institution | 1.76% | 127,543,889 | |
| 836,214 | Institution | 0.90% | 65,483,918 | |
| 638,172 | Institution | 0.69% | 49,975,249 | |
| 590,326 | Institution | 0.64% | 46,228,429 | |
| 504,032 | Institution | 0.54% | 39,470,746 | |
| 503,880 | Institution | 0.54% | 39,458,843 | |
| 485,683 | Institution | 0.52% | 38,033,836 | |
| 451,481 | Institution | 0.49% | 35,355,477 | |
| 442,900 | Institution | 0.48% | 34,683,499 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 5,100,974 | Institution | 5.50% | 399,457,274 | |
| 2,922,767 | Institution | 3.15% | 228,297,330 | |
| 2,093,070 | Institution | 2.26% | 163,489,698 | |
| 1,641,758 | Institution | 1.77% | 128,237,717 | |
| 1,343,769 | Institution | 1.45% | 104,961,797 | |
| 963,243 | Institution | 1.04% | 75,248,543 | |
| 908,183 | Institution | 0.98% | 70,938,174 | |
| 784,307 | Institution | 0.85% | 61,270,063 | |
| 523,521 | Institution | 0.56% | 40,897,461 | |
| 451,208 | Institution | 0.49% | 35,248,369 |